Crucial Element of Compliance
![ADA Signs](https://connectingsigns.com/wp-content/uploads/2022/03/ada-room-identification-sign-1080x675.jpg)
Placement is important; indicators must be installed in places that are quickly visible and reachable. Usually, signage must be installed between 48 and 60 inches from the ground to make sure access for both standing and mobility device users. Tactile elements, such as Braille, are necessary for people with visual disabilities, giving essential details in a non-visual layout.
High-contrast colors between the text and background are needed to enhance readability for people with reduced vision. The ADA mandates particular comparison proportions to guarantee quality. In addition, character size is an essential consideration, with minimal height needs dictated by the seeing range to make certain readability from different angles.
Design Considerations for Availability
Creating easily accessible signage calls for a thorough approach to ensure it fulfills the demands of all individuals, specifically those with specials needs. This includes considering different design components that enhance readability and use. Secret factors consist of the choice of font style, shade comparison, and tactile features. Typefaces should be sans-serif, with clear and easy letterforms, to assist in very easy analysis. The size of the text is just as crucial, with ADA guidelines recommending a minimal elevation based on watching distance to ensure readability.
Contrasting shades between message and background are crucial for presence, especially for people with visual impairments. Additionally, responsive components, such as Braille and elevated characters, are vital for individuals that are blind or have low vision.
In addition, the placement of signage plays a significant function in ease of access. Signs must be set up in locations that are quickly reachable and unhampered. Making certain that signage is mounted at proper elevations and angles enables all customers, including those utilizing wheelchairs, to communicate with them efficiently.
